Episode 184: Cenk Uygur

Jul 27, 2024
Cenk Uygur, a political commentator and activist known for his work on progressive issues, dives into Kamala Harris's presidential campaign. He critiques recent political controversies and discusses the hypocrisy surrounding free speech and media bias, especially regarding the Israeli-Palestinian conflict. The conversation reveals insights into the shifting dynamics of the Democratic Party, the implications of Biden's exit, and the challenges in addressing immigration. Uygur also compares Harris's prospects with Donald Trump while highlighting the impact of political allegiances.

Biden's Political Landscape and Challenges

The episode highlights the shifting political landscape following Joe Biden's withdrawal from the race, emphasizing the challenges faced by the Democratic Party. Biden's departure has raised concerns about the establishment's control and the potential for a more progressive candidate to emerge. The discussion points out how various establishment Democrats are responding to the evolving situation, with some acknowledging the need for a more inclusive approach, while others appear reluctant to endorse Kamala Harris, the likely nominee. This ambivalence reflects the established power dynamics within the party and leaves many questioning the direction of the Democratic Party under her leadership.
